diff --git a/diff.c b/diff.c
index 69f0357..13dfc3e 100644
--- a/diff.c
+++ b/diff.c@@ -4751,7 +4751,7 @@ int diff_opt_parse(struct diff_options *options, } else if (!strcmp(arg, "--exit-code")) DIFF_OPT_SET(options, EXIT_WITH_STATUS); - else if (!strcmp(arg, "--quiet")) + else if (!strcmp(arg, "-q") || !strcmp(arg, "--quiet")) DIFF_OPT_SET(options, QUICK); else if (!strcmp(arg, "--ext-diff")) DIFF_OPT_SET(options, ALLOW_EXTERNAL);
